Linde E25 Warning Light Symbols and What They Mean

The Linde E25 is an electric counterbalance forklift designed for intensive indoor and outdoor material handling. Its instrument cluster provides operators with essential status and warning indicators to ensure safe and efficient operation. Understanding these symbols is crucial for maintaining performance and avoiding costly downtime.

How to read the colors: Red icons signal immediate hazards or critical malfunctions and require the forklift to be stopped. Amber lights indicate issues that need attention soon, while green or blue icons show normal operational statuses or active features.

Most Important Warning Lights

Master Warning (Stop)

Common causes

  • Major electrical failure
  • Severe hydraulic leak
  • Critical brake malfunction

What to do

Immediately stop the E25, disconnect power, and contact Linde service to diagnose and repair the root cause.

Battery / Charging

Common causes

  • Deep battery discharge
  • Charger malfunction
  • Loose or corroded battery connections

What to do

Inspect battery terminals and charger; recharge the traction battery fully before resuming use.

Overload / Capacity

Common causes

  • Load exceeds rated capacity
  • Incorrect load positioning
  • Faulty load sensor

What to do

Remove excess weight, reposition load as per the E25 manual, and check load sensors if the warning persists.

Brake System

Common causes

  • Hydraulic brake fluid loss
  • Worn brake pads or discs
  • Electronic brake control fault

What to do

Inspect brake fluid level and components; arrange for immediate repair before operating the E25 again.

Frequently Asked Questions

What should I do if the BDI (Battery Discharge Indicator) turns amber on my Linde E25?

Plan to recharge the battery soon, as continued operation may trigger automatic power reduction to protect the battery.

Why is the overload symbol flashing on my E25 even with a light load?

Check if the load is positioned correctly and ensure the load sensor is functioning; recalibrate if necessary.

Can I drive the E25 if the ABS warning is lit?

You can continue cautiously, but braking performance may be reduced; have the ABS system inspected as soon as possible.

How do I reset the service/hour meter indicator?

After completing scheduled maintenance, reset the hour meter via the cluster menu or using a service tool as described in the E25 manual.

What does it mean if the hydraulic system light comes on?

It indicates a potential hydraulic fluid issue or system fault; check fluid level and inspect for leaks before further use.
